Not content with merely launching The Junction’s buzziest new spot, Playa Cabana owner Dave Sidhu is opening a third location of his Mexican restaurant and tequila bar this May at 14 Dupont Street. Dubbed Playa Cabana Hacienda, the restaurant’s menu will echo those of Playa Cabana and Playa Cabana Cantina, but with an added selection of wood-smoked meats as well. Hacienda will be the chain’s largest incarnation, with a capacity of just under 140 seats spread over three floors and two patios (as at the Annex and Junction locations, the restaurant will take reservations through its website). Manager Matthew King tells us that if Hacienda is as successful as its predecessors, Toronto taco lovers could easily see a fourth Playa Cabana before long.
